There are several scenarios that may require you to obtain SR22 insurance in Newport, Arkansas. One common situation is if you have been convicted of a DUI or DWI. In Arkansas, a first-time DUI offense can result in a license suspension of six months, and you may be required to file an SR22 form with the state in order to have your license reinstated.

Another scenario that may require SR22 insurance is if you have been caught driving without insurance. In Arkansas, all drivers are required to carry a minimum amount of liability insurance, and if you are caught driving without it, you may be required to file an SR22 form in order to have your license reinstated.

If you have been involved in multiple at-fault accidents or have accumulated a high number of traffic violations, you may also be required to obtain SR22 insurance. In these cases, the state may see you as a high-risk driver and require you to carry SR22 insurance in order to legally drive on the roads.

Finally, if you are a non-owner driver and are required to file an SR22 form, you can still obtain non-owner SR22 insurance. This type of insurance provides liability coverage when you are driving a vehicle that you do not own.

1. What is SR22 insurance?

SR22 insurance is a type of car insurance that is required for drivers who have been convicted of certain offenses, such as DUIs or driving without insurance. It is a form that is filed with the state to prove that you have the required amount of liability insurance coverage.

2. How long do I need to carry SR22 insurance?

The length of time you need to carry SR22 insurance can vary depending on the offense you were convicted of. In Arkansas, you may need to carry SR22 insurance for up to three years.

7. Can I switch insurance companies while carrying SR22 insurance?

Yes, you can switch insurance companies while carrying SR22 insurance. Be sure to notify your current insurance company that you will be canceling your policy so they can file the necessary paperwork with the state.

8. What happens if I let my SR22 insurance lapse?

If you let your SR22 insurance lapse, your insurance company is required to notify the state, and your license may be suspended. It’s important to stay current on your SR22 insurance to avoid any legal consequences.
